Ten teams want Widar, but Lotto locks him down

Belgian talent Jarno Widar looks set to remain with the Lotto Dstny development team for the 2025 season, despite interest from as many as 10 WorldTour teams.
The 18-year-old is one of the most sought-after young riders after winning the Alpes Isère Tour, the Giro d'Italia Next Gen and the Giro della Valle d'Aosta in 2024, in his first year among the Under 23s.
